Senior Software Engineer, SugarCRM Specialist
Calling All Upstarters!
SUGARCRM SPECIALIST WANTED!
We are Upstart 13. We are humble, hungry, and competent people who are radically changing the expectations and experience of outsourcing for all participants by challenging barriers that create inequality and by bringing down borders in technology for people everywhere. We’re all about delivering value and doing big things. We have become a game-changer for teams around the world who look to Upstart’s services as a differentiator.
Job Description:
We are seeking a Senior SugarCRM Engineer located in Latin America to act as the technical subject matter expert for SugarCRM environments. This role covers application customization, performance optimization, environment administration, and version/data migrations from legacy on-prem to SugarCloud. You will work across two business-critical domains: Adoptions & case management (core operational system of record) and donor management (fundraising, events, and donations).
You’ll own both proactive development (new features, upgrades) and reactive support (troubleshooting, Sugar support liaison), ensuring SugarCRM runs optimally, securely, and upgrade-safe.
Responsibilities:
SugarCRM Customization & Development:
- Build and maintain upgrade-safe customizations (modules, logic hooks, dashlets, REST APIs, custom views).
- Configure via Studio, Module Builder, and Metadata framework, adhering to Sugar best practices.
- Apply PHP and JavaScript skills within the Sugar framework (not just generic web dev).
Upgrades & Migrations:
- Lead legacy-to-SugarCloud migrations (v9 → v14+), including code remediation, module compatibility, and regression testing.
- Perform data migrations in collaboration with data engineers, ensuring schema understanding and data integrity.
- Design and execute migration strategies when the standard upgrade path is not viable.
Support & SME Duties:
- Serve as SugarCRM technical SME for Gladney teams and partner developers.
- Troubleshoot and resolve escalations via SugarCRM Support.
- Guide on best practices for customization efficiency and upgrade readiness.
Qualifications
Technical skills:
- Bachelor’s degree in Computer Science, Software Engineering, or equivalent practical experience.
- 5+ years of SugarCRM core development and customization experience.
- Deep knowledge of Module Loader, Logic Hooks, Beans, Sugar Studio / Metadata framework, REST/API, Upgrade-Safe patterns.
- Well-versed in PHP 8.x, HTML/CSS/JS/Bootstrap.
- Experience with Elasticsearch.
- Skilled in database optimization (MySQL), REST API integrations, and ETL collaboration.
- Knowledge of secure software development best practices in SugarCRM.
- Comfortable with Linux environments, Docker, Git, and CI/CD.
Soft skills:
- Excellent analytical, communication, and English documentation skills.
- Able to work through ambiguity in a fast-paced, dynamically changing business environment with minimal supervision.
- Excellent collaboration skills with a desire to learn and teach.
- Excellent understanding of development processes and agile methodologies.
- Enthusiastic, highly motivated, and able to learn quickly.
- A willingness to get your hands dirty - you enjoy a scrappy, entrepreneurial environment where everyone pitches in to get the job done.
Bonus skills:
- Prior experience moving on-prem SugarCRM to SugarCloud managed hosting, including data and custom code.
- SugarCRM Certified Developer Specialist or Solutions Architect.
- Experience managing environment tuning (web server, PHP, Elasticsearch, MySQL).
- Experience interpreting PHP Info, performance logs, and query explain plans to identify bottlenecks.
- Experience recommending and implementing scaling strategies (multi-web-server setups, database optimization).
Why Upstart13?
- We put people first at Upstart 13! We believe the world is filled with amazing people and we are willing to go to great lengths to seek out others who share our values to join our cause of bringing down borders in technology for people everywhere.
- We develop leaders at Upstart 13, we focus on what matters to do meaningful work, we own our shit, we stay curious, and we understand responsibility leads to
giving. We do big things together!
Perks:
- Job type: a long-term, full-time job.
- Fully remote.
- USD competitive salary.
- 20+ Paid time off days.

Are you ready to join our cause? Be sure to ask, “Why 13?”
- Department
- Software Development
- Role
- Backend Developer
- Remote status
- Fully Remote
- Employment type
- Full-time

About Upstart 13
We build software people love #BeYou #ShowYouCare #SolveProblems
We aimed to disrupt the industry; it was overdue and needed. Outsourcing had run its course in its current form.
Customers faced bad quality and unpredictability; engineers were left with menial tasks.
Everyone wanted more, and we could offer it. Inspired by LATAM culture, fueled by its people, and shaped by our mission,
Upstart 13 was born
Already working at Upstart 13?
Let’s recruit together and find your next colleague.